Jet Airways to evolve into uniform full service single brand

In line with its recent announcement of a uniform “single brand”, Jet Airways will commence streamlining and aligning its domestic operations into a single full service product to provide an enhanced and consistent product experience.

As the first, of many upcoming initiatives, all guests booking flights on or after September 15th 2014 for travel on or after December 1st 2014, will enjoy the full service experience onboard all Jet Airways and JetKonnect operated flights across the domestic network. The enhancement into a uniform, full service single brand will include a complementary meal service onboard all flights* for travel effective December 1st 2014, and Sky Café – the airline buy on board service - will be discontinued.

JetPrivilege members will also earn JPMiles in line with the accrual structure for full service flights. Guests currently booked on JetKonnect (Buy on Board flights) and holding tickets bearing flight numbers commencing with S2 and S2* for travel effective December 1st 2014 will continue to enjoy seamless service accompanied with a complementary meal service onboard all flights*.
